Ronny Young gets win in altered ‘Shockwave’

“Blue Max” AA/FC pilot Ronny Young stepped back into the “Shockwave” Saturday night, Aug. 19, during the Outlaw Fuel Altered Night of Fire held at North Star Dragway in Denton, Texas.

 

Young who began his funny car career at the wheel of the “Shockwave”, subbed for current owner, Bobby Marriot, who is recovering from a shoulder injury. With the help of former “Shockwave” partner, Terry Darby, it didn't take long for Young to fit right in the Altered style.

 

The three ripped off a 3.96 in the first qualifying round, and defeated another former All American Funny Car pilot, Jimmy Jones, in round one. The “Shockwave” gang then posted a 3.84 in the finals to defeat last year’s champion, Raymond Dawson, who posted a solid 3.89.

Norwalk hosts NMCA this weekend

The NMCA All-American Nationals is the second event of the Chevrolet Performance Challenge Series whose class headliner is LSX Drag Radial.

 

The NMCA’s penultimate event of the year, the All-American Nationals, takes place at Summit Motorsports Park in Norwalk, OH, this weekend, Aug. 24-27.

 

Sponsored by E3 Spark Plugs, the Honeywell Garrett NMCA All-American Nationals features heads-up Xtreme Pro Mods, Radial Wars, Factory Super Cars, Street Outlaws, Nostalgia Super Stockers and much more. Other classes include Nitrous Pro Street, Xtreme Street, N/A 10.5, and Stock.

 

Saturday will see special race classes including the Ford Performance Cobra Jet Showdown, the F.A.S.T. group, a Top Sportsman Challenge, and the Chevrolet Performance Challenge Series. 

NHDRO World Finals set for end of September at Indy

DME Racing and Pro Stock Inc. have signed on as title sponsors of the NHDRO World Finals on Sept. 29-Oct. 1 at Lucas Oil Raceway Park near Indianapolis.

 

Since rain postponed the August race, there will be two complete Pro Street races in September in addition to the annual Pro Street Shootout. The Top Gas, Super Comp, Crazy 8s and Street Fighter classes also will be finishing their postponed August competition.

 

With the exception of Street Fighter, which John Markham has dominated all year, the other three sportsman categories have very tight championship battles going on as they head into the double-header season finale.

 

Pro Nitrous, Pro Open, and Pro Ultra are the other classes slated for the event. And, of course, grudge racing gets underway after the Shootout class on Saturday night. 

Three generations of Gray family to compete at U.S. Nationals

Johnny Gray      Shane (near lane) and Tanner Gray

 

Tanner Gray has certainly had a successful rookie season, but when you consider where he comes from, you can understand why that might not be quite so remarkable. Grandfather, Johnny Gray, and father, Shane Gray, also were successful in NHRA Pro Stock racing over the years. Johnny has retired from active racing but Shane stills competes at selected events.

 

However, all three generations will all be driving at this year’s U.S. Nationals on the Labor Day weekend.

 

“It will be a lot of fun,” the youngest Gray said. “I get to race with my grandpa. I’ve got to race my dad over the years, but I’m really looking forward to that. Hopefully, we can give my grandpa a good car so he could go out there and win the thing. That would be cool.”

 

Eighteen-year-old Tanner seems practically a shoe-in for Rookie of the Year honors, and could even win the championship. He is in second place in the points going into the last race before the points re-rack for the six-race Countdown to the Championship.

 

“If you would have told me I would win four races my first year, I would have told you that you were crazy,” Tanner said. “We definitely have something going and it’s clicking at the right time.” 

Holley LS Fest at Bowling Green in September

If you have a race car, muscle car, rat rod, street rod, or truck powered by an LS or current-generation LT engine, there's only one place to be Sept. 8-10: Holley's 8th annual LS Fest. Held at world-famous Beech Bend Raceway Park in Holley's hometown of Bowling Green, KY, it's the place to be for everything LS-related – drag racing, autocross, drifting, road-course racing, a 3S challenge, a dyno competition, and a car show/swap meet and more.

New TorqStorm Supercharger Twin Kits

TorqStorm is introducing two new centrifugal supercharger kits for GM LS transplant engines. The twin kit supports 1,000-plus horsepower while the single sustains 700 plus. Both can be adapted for use with EFI or carburetion. Whether supplied as twin or single, the kits include a Sanden air conditioning compressor, Turn One power steering pump, and Powermaster alternator—the first such integrated kits furnished in the company’s history. In addition, TorqStorm provides two serpentine belts, an eight-rib to drive the supercharger and a six-rib to impel the accessories; all necessary pulleys, including a tool steel hub for the crank pulley; two self-adjusting tensioners, a blow-off valve; an air filter plus all the necessary mounting brackets and fasteners. To complete the twin kit, a second supercharger, blow-off valve and air filter is added. Available in natural alloy or black anodized or with a micro-polished finish, both supercharger kits go on sale in September.
